Runbook: account recovery — Ovenlight cutoff rule. If the cutoff-rule service account locks out, same-day bakery orders at Crumbward stop gating at noon. Steps: confirm lockout in Ovenlight admin, reset the session, re-arm the cutoff job. To finish recovery, enter the passphrase below at the unlock prompt.

unlock words, yagag-yahog: gordor-zorvan-druius-queniel-normir-norwyn-framir-novmir-ralius-holwyn-wenwyn-tamael-silok-holdor

Action item: disable per-message deflate on Quillon's websocket tier for the next release. Compression saved ~30% bandwidth but the context-takeover memory cost caused the OOM cascade during the spike. Replace with selective compression for payloads over 8 KB, no context takeover. Benchmarks pending from the Larkspur cluster. Track rollout behind a flag; flip after 48h soak. Full tradeoff analysis and benchmark results are on the internal page here.

operations page: https://jira.qorvelsys.internal/browse/pages/browse/pages

## Step 6: Telemetry Gateway Cutover

Switch the Furrowlink gateway to the v3 ingest path. Reviewer checklist: confirm the MQTT bridge is disabled, the batch flusher uses the new serializer, and backpressure limits match the fleet size quoted in the capacity doc. Old config keys are rejected at boot, so diff carefully. The replacement configuration is shown below.

service settings:
[casax]
port = 6379
team = rusir
host = casax.zemvarhq.corp
region = outer-4
access_code = ac_9808ce
timeout_ms = 1500

Quarterly Planning Note — Logistics Provider Change

From the start of next quarter, Fernvale Retail will move all regional distribution from Koretta Freight to Dalwick Logistics. Expect a two-week transition with adjusted delivery windows; branch managers should update receiving rotas accordingly. Service levels are contractually improved, and costs fall roughly eight percent. The switch also sets the stage for the following.

board note of hafog-kafop: Only 50 of the 505 pilot accounts renewed Eliys, so a churn review is set for April 7. Fravanox Partners is in early talks to buy Tamvanix Logistics for about $273.9 million.